RHEL 7の/var/lib/dockerでIsilon NFSを使用する

RHEL 7の/var/lib/dockerでIsilon NFSを使用する

RHEL:7.8ドッカー:1.13.1

サーバーは複数のチームで共有され、ノートブックにDockerをインストールできない人やインストールできない人がテストやサンドボックスにDockerを使用できるようにしたいと思います。共有されているため、イメージが大きくなる可能性があるため、Isilon NFS共有を/var/lib/dockerとしてマウントしたいと思います。動作させるためにストレージドライバとして「vfs」を使用しましたが、これが次のエラーの原因だと思います。

ERROR: for redis  Cannot create container for service redis: SELinux relabeling of <mount_point>/volumes/1185719ebf09771e9e9641f329c9c57f72792a942c283562f701ece914cca82a/_data is not allowed: "operation not supported"

"chcon -Rt svirt_sandbox_file_t <mount_point>"を試してみるように提案しましたが、同じ "タスクがサポートされていません"エラーが発生しました。

他の人にこれを働かせましたか?私は間違った方向に行っているのだろうか?

答え1

RHEL dockerをアンインストールし、docker.comからdocker 19.03.13をインストールして問題を解決しました。気になる方のために:

[root@oitleap01 ~]# docker info
Client:
 Debug Mode: false

Server:
 Containers: 0
  Running: 0
  Paused: 0
  Stopped: 0
 Images: 0
 Server Version: 19.03.13
 Storage Driver: devicemapper
  Pool Name: docker-0:61-7297578891-pool
  Pool Blocksize: 65.54kB
  Base Device Size: 10.74GB
  Backing Filesystem: xfs
  Udev Sync Supported: true
  Data file: /dev/loop0
  Metadata file: /dev/loop1
  Data loop file: /net/oitfile01/ifs/oitisilon/oit/Unix/ReplicatedData/UnixTeam/docker/oitleap01/devicemapper/devicemapper/data
  Metadata loop file: /net/oitfile01/ifs/oitisilon/oit/Unix/ReplicatedData/UnixTeam/docker/oitleap01/devicemapper/devicemapper/metadata
  Data Space Used: 11.73MB
  Data Space Total: 107.4GB
  Data Space Available: 107.4GB
  Metadata Space Used: 17.36MB
  Metadata Space Total: 2.147GB
  Metadata Space Available: 2.13GB
  Thin Pool Minimum Free Space: 10.74GB
  Deferred Removal Enabled: true
  Deferred Deletion Enabled: true
  Deferred Deleted Device Count: 0
  Library Version: 1.02.164-RHEL7 (2019-08-27)
...
Docker Root Dir: <mount point>
...
WARNING: the devicemapper storage-driver is deprecated, and will be removed in a future release.
WARNING: devicemapper: usage of loopback devices is strongly discouraged for production use.
         Use `--storage-opt dm.thinpooldev` to specify a custom block storage device.

関連情報